Warning Signs You Need Frozen Pipe Water Removal

Ignoring these warning signs can lead to costly repairs and further damage. Catching them early can save you thousands of dollars and prevent bigger problems.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ors can show hidden water damage or mold growth. If you notice persistent musty smells, it’s time to call our team.

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ls

Water stains can be a sign of a leak or burst pipe. If you notice water spots or discoloration on your ceilings or walls, don’t ignore it, call us today.

Unusual Noises Coming from Pipes

Clanking, banging, or gurgling noises can show a frozen or burst pipe. If you hear unusual sounds coming from your pipes, it’s time to act fast.

Low Water Pressure

Reduced water pressure can be a sign of a frozen or clogged pipe. If you notice a decrease in water pressure, call our team to investigate.

Water Leaks Under Sinks or Toilets

Leaks under sinks or toilets can be a sign of a frozen or burst pipe. If you notice water leaks or puddles, don’t delay, call us today.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can show water damage or a burst pipe. If you notice uneven or damaged flooring, it’s time to call our team.

Frozen Pipe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ak under a sink Yes No DIY fixes are usually enough for small leaks.
Large water damage from a burst pipe No Yes Professional equipment and expertise are needed to safely remove water and prevent further damage.
Hidden water damage behind walls or ceilings No Yes Hidden water damage needs specialized equipment and expertise to detect and repair.
Water damage in a crawl space or basement No Yes These areas are prone to moisture and need specialized equipment to safely remove water and prevent mold growth.
Water damage in a high-traffic area Maybe Yes High-traffic areas need quick and efficient drying to prevent further damage and safety hazards.
Water damage in a commercial property No Yes Commercial properties need specialized equipment and expertise to safely remove water and prevent further damage.

Frozen Pipe Water Removal Cost in Euclid, OH

The cost of Frozen Pipe Water Removal varies based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Euclid, OH. These estimates are based on real-world costs and can vary depending on your specific situ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water removal and ext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area and amount of water
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area and type of materials
Cleaning and sanitizing $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area and type of surfaces
Restoration and reconstruction $2,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area and type of materials
Equipment rental and labor $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area and type of equipment needed
More services (e.g., mold remediation) $1,000 – $5,000 Severity of damage and type of service needed
